Rumah  >  Artikel  >  pangkalan data  >  Bagaimana untuk melihat prosedur tersimpan dalam pangkalan data oracle

Bagaimana untuk melihat prosedur tersimpan dalam pangkalan data oracle

下次还敢
下次还敢asal
2024-04-19 03:03:22832semak imbas

Anda boleh melihat prosedur tersimpan dalam pangkalan data Oracle melalui langkah berikut: 1. Sambung ke pangkalan data 2. Dapatkan senarai prosedur tersimpan 3. Lihat kod prosedur tersimpan;

Bagaimana untuk melihat prosedur tersimpan dalam pangkalan data oracle

Cara melihat prosedur yang disimpan dalam pangkalan data Oracle

Untuk melihat prosedur yang disimpan dalam pangkalan data Oracle, anda boleh mengambil langkah berikut:

1.

  • Buka SQL *Plus, Oracle SQL Developer atau mana-mana alat lain yang membolehkan anda menyambung ke pangkalan data Oracle.

2. Sambung ke pangkalan data

  • Masukkan nama pengguna dan kata laluan anda untuk menyambung ke pangkalan data.

3. Dapatkan senarai prosedur yang disimpan

  • Jalankan pertanyaan berikut untuk mendapatkan senarai semua prosedur yang disimpan:
<code class="sql">SELECT object_name
FROM user_procedures;</code>

Pertanyaan ini akan mengembalikan nama semua skema prosedur yang disimpan dalam skema semasa.

4. Lihat kod prosedur tersimpan

  • Untuk melihat kod bagi prosedur tersimpan tertentu, jalankan pertanyaan berikut:
<code class="sql">SHOW CREATE PROCEDURE procedure_name;</code>

di mana procedure_name ialah nama prosedur tersimpan yang kodnya anda ingin melihat. procedure_name 是要查看其代码的存储过程的名称。

此查询将显示存储过程的创建语句,包括其参数、局部变量和代码体。

5. 查看存储过程文档

  • 要查看存储过程的文档(如果有),请运行以下查询:
<code class="sql">SELECT comments
FROM user_procedures
WHERE object_name = 'procedure_name';</code>

此查询将显示存储在数据库中的存储过程注释,如果存储过程有注释的话。

示例

以下是一个查看名为 GetCustomer

Pertanyaan ini akan memaparkan pernyataan penciptaan prosedur yang disimpan, termasuk parameternya, pembolehubah setempat dan badan kod.

🎜5. Lihat dokumentasi prosedur tersimpan 🎜🎜🎜🎜Untuk melihat dokumentasi bagi prosedur tersimpan (jika ada), jalankan pertanyaan berikut: 🎜🎜
<code class="sql">SHOW CREATE PROCEDURE GetCustomer;

SELECT comments
FROM user_procedures
WHERE object_name = 'GetCustomer';</code>
🎜Pertanyaan ini akan memaparkan ulasan prosedur tersimpan yang disimpan dalam pangkalan data, jika prosedur tersimpan mempunyai satu Komen. 🎜🎜🎜Contoh🎜🎜🎜Berikut ialah contoh melihat kod dan dokumentasi untuk prosedur tersimpan bernama GetCustomer: 🎜rrreee🎜Ini akan memaparkan pernyataan penciptaan dan ulasan untuk prosedur tersimpan (jika ada) . 🎜

Atas ialah kandungan terperinci Bagaimana untuk melihat prosedur tersimpan dalam pangkalan data oracle.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Kenyataan:
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n